I remember watching Apollo 13 when it first came out at the cinema in 1995. Base on the real events of the unsuccessful moon mission in 1970, it would have been possible to hear a pin drop as the entire audience watched as the events unfolded - and this was even when we knew what happened.
For the purpose of this review I am going to assume that most people know the story of Apollo 13 - if you don't and you are likely to watch the film it's probably ... ...on the Apollo 13 mission which was intended to be the third moon landing by US astronauts. The mission was led by Commander Jim Lovell (played by Tom hanks) who had already circled the moon on an earlier mission. His crew was meant to be Fred Haise (Bill Paton) and Ken Mattingly (Gary Sinise) but a threat of contracting the measles while in Space meant that Mattingly could not go and his place was taken by Jack Swigert (Kevin Bacon). ...Neil Armstrong and Buzz Aldrin, Apollo 13 was scheduled for a moon landing of its own. The original crew of Jim Lovell (Tom Hanks), Fred Haise (Bill Paxton) and Ken Mattingley (Gary Sinise) are just days away from the launch when Mattingley is pulled from the team due to the belief that he may have been exposed to infection. Jack Swigert (Kevin Bacon) steps inand after a routine launch, disaster strikes, leading to the immortal line "Houston, we ... ...a spacecraft that is rapidly losing both power and oxygen, the astronauts fight for their lives in a desperate struggle. Meanwhile, back at mission contriol, Mattingley returns to help in a heroic race to bring them home safely.
